Locked Out

The Audi car keyfob is a convenience that will make your Virginia Beach driving more enjoyable. However, the battery in this key fob can wear out and it is important to understand how to open audi car when it occurs. Audi drivers are advised not to employ metal tools such as coat hanger wires and knives to unlock their cars. They can damage the body of the vehicle or its central locking system. To avoid this, call a roadside assistance provider to unlock your car's doors in case you're locked out. They'll have lockout tools that won't cause damage to your Audi.

Keys that are misplaced

Nearly everyone has lost keys to their car at one point, whether they set them at the counter of a coffee shop and do not remember to pick them up or they are lost in the shuffle when getting out of the car to drop children off at school. Audi offers an easy and affordable method to replace lost car keys.

Before you panic, search in all the obvious spots. You might be able to locate it in your pocket, purse or bag, or retrace your steps from the last time you used it. If you are unable to locate it, contact your dealer or auto locksmith to come and create a new one for you.

To prove that you own the car You'll need to present your photo ID and registration documents to the dealer or locksmith. It will help to prevent any fraudulent activities, so it's important that you always keep these documents in the glove compartment or wallet.

After confirming your identity, a dealer or locksmith will create a new Audi key for you by using an Audi scanner. This is to make sure that the key matches the immobiliser on the car and that it is unable to be used to run away.

Lost Keys

One of the perks that comes with driving an Audi vehicle is the ability to unlock and start it without reaching inside your purse or pocket. This feature can be a huge help when you are carrying groceries or children into the car and don't want to be forced to stop your car to get to your keys. Like any other high-tech device key fob, the key fob is going to wear out eventually. You may need to replace it. Replacing the Audi key fob isn't as simple as ordering an equivalent replacement from the local auto parts store. You'll need to consult an authorized Audi dealer to purchase a new one and have it programmed to your vehicle. The process could take as long as a week after you have provided all the necessary documentation. You will need to pay an additional fee to have the more info new key programmed, to allow it to start your vehicle and open your doors.

Be sure to bring your photo ID and registration papers to the dealership before you get a replacement Audi key. This will allow the dealer or the locksmith to confirm that you are the owner of the vehicle and can proceed with the replacement process.

After the dealership or the locksmith has verified that you are the owner of the vehicle, they will order an additional key for you. This process can take up to an entire week. They will also need to program the new key so that it can open your doors and start the engine. They will require the details for the immobilizer on your vehicle and may require a specialized tool to reprogram the new website key.
